To the release manager: I'm passing ownership of the Pellwick deep-link router to Sorrel before the 4.2 cut. The intent-matching table now lives in the Farrowgate config service; stale entries were purged last sprint. Watch the fallback route — it silently swallows malformed slugs, which inflated our drop-off metrics in March. The staging resolver needs its keystore unlocked before each regression pass, and that keystore accepts only one credential. For the signing vault, the recovery phrase is noted directly below.

recovery phrase for tafog-fafog: novix-novdor-fraath-brieth-olieth-oliix-rusix-wenion-julax-druox

# Break-Glass: Catalog Cache Invalidation

Scope: the Pinrow product catalog at Veldstone Retail. If stale prices persist after a purge and the Hollowmere invalidation queue is wedged, use break-glass to flush the edge tier directly. Contractors: get verbal sign-off from the catalog lead first. Steps: open the Hollowmere admin shell, select emergency-flush, confirm the tenant, and run it once — repeated flushes thrash the origin. Access is logged and expires after 20 minutes. Unseal the admin shell with the passphrase below.

recovery phrase for kahop-tajog: istix-casvan

### Action item 4: tighten token refresh windows

Owner: on-call rotation. The Mossvale session service refreshed tokens inside the expiry grace window, so concurrent tabs raced and invalidated each other. Fix lands in the next Pellerin release; until then, the on-call engineer should verify refresh skew stays under the alert threshold after each deploy. Reference values for the refresh scheduler are listed below.

constants for tafog-kahag:
RATE_LIMITS = {
    "sorir": 697,
    "oliox": 683,
    "holax": 176,
    "casox": 60,
    "pelius": 382,
}

Subject: Ownership change — Keyturn rotation utility

Effective Monday, responsibility for the Keyturn secrets-rotation utility transfers off my plate. Rotation schedules, vault adapter maintenance, and failed-rotation alerts will all route to the new owner. Runbooks remain in the ops wiki unchanged; escalation paths update automatically. For any rotation failures during on-call, page the new owner, whose name appears below.

account owner for bawip-tahag: Raleth Quenok